The Property Maintenance Technician at Anaheim Memorial Manor , a 75 -unit senior residential community in Anaheim, CA is responsible for maintaining the physical condition and appearance of the property, including buildings, common areas, and grounds. This position supports the Property Manager in daily property operations by performing general maintenance, responding to and completing service requests in a timely manner, and assisting with apartment turnover.
The ideal candidate is organized, dependable, and service-oriented, with the ability to maintain organized maintenance areas and storage spaces, manage inventory and supplies, follow established safety standards and practices, and communicate effectively with residents, vendors, and team members. This role plays an important part in ensuring the community remains safe, clean, functional, and welcoming for residents.

Actual base salary considers several factors including but not limited to geography, job-related knowledge, experience, and budget. The start of the salary range is typically associated with the minimum experience required.
The role is considered Full-Time non-exempt and will be eligible for overtime pay in accordance with federal and state law. The anticipated base pay range for this position is $22.00–$24.00 per hour.
